Historical Note

Walter McElreath was an Atlanta attorney, businessman and chairman of the board of the Atlanta Federal Savings and Loan. He was also one of the founders of the Atlanta Historical Society.

Scope and Content

The collection consists of papers of Walter McElreath from 1910-1949. The papers contain writings and speeches of McElreath. The majority of the writings deal with the Georgia Constitution and Georgia history. The speeches, given before bar associations, historical groups, and while he was in the legislature, deal with Georgia government and politics, law, the Georgia constitution, and Georgia history.
